I didn't make it out to Meat Market Vintage's grand opening party, but I did stop in last week. If you're looking for a well-curated stock of vintage duds, the place is a goldmine.

I couldn't fit into the Mike Oldfield "Tubular Bells"/Puma '84 concert tee, but I'm sure it's just a matter of time before I spot some local rocker sporting it on stage.

Brad Dwyer doesn't dish much on the fashions displayed Meat Market, instead catching local band The Rebel Set in the midst of a typically loud set and dealing with the unique problems of bringing a toddler to a punk show.
